How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Douglas County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Douglas County Studio Apartments | $1,164 | $475 | $4,434 |
| Douglas County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,288 | $510 | $3,327 |
| Douglas County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,724 | $620 | $4,182 |
| Douglas County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,182 | $965 | $4,263 |
| Douglas County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,431 | $649 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Douglas County
How much are Studio apartments in Douglas County?
There are currently 618 Studio Apartments in Douglas County with rent ranges from $550 to $4,434 with an average price of $1,953.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Douglas County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Douglas County ranges from $510 to $3,327 with an average monthly rent of $1,288.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Douglas County c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Douglas County range from $620 to $4,182.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,724.
How expensive are Douglas County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 216 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Douglas County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$965 to $4,263 - averaging $2,182 for the location.
